基于双层规划的虚拟物流企业联盟伙伴选择模型及求解算法

摘    要:虚拟物流企业联盟是21世纪信息社会物流行业的主流组织形式,选择和确定联盟伙伴是建立虚拟物流企业联盟的关键环节之一,对提高联盟企业的总体竞争力有着极其重要的作用。在充分考虑联盟与客户双方利益的情况下,设计了基于双层规划的模型和求解算法来优选联盟伙伴,并且模型中在计算物流企业为客户服务的作业成本时,考虑了配送路线安排对作业成本的影响,更加符合实际情况,使计算结果更加准确。实例仿真说明了模型和算法的有效性。

A Model and Solution Algorithm Based on Bi-level Programming for the Partner Selecting of Virtual Logistics Enterprise Alliance

Abstract:Virtual logistics enterprise alliance (VLEA) is a mainstream organizational form for logistics in the information society of the 21st century. Correct selection of partners is one of the key links in establishing a VLEA and also plays a vital role in reinforcing its competitiveness. With the benefit of the cost of both the VLEA and its clients ,a two-level programming model and a heuristic solution algorithm are presented to describe the optimization for the partner selection of VLEA. Moreover, when the cost is calculated that the enterprise service for its clients in the model, the effect of routing arrangement of distribution upon the cost is considered, which is more up to the actual situation and make the calculated value more exact. A simulating case will demonstrate the effectiveness of the selection model and the algorithm.
